POSITION SUMMARY
The Nursing Supervisor provides medical care to the residents of the YOC and also provides oversight of the medical care being provided by other YOC nurses. The Nursing Supervisor is also responsible for ordering and maintaining medical supplies and equipment, the maintenance of client medical records, and oversight of medication administration. Additional responsibilities include management of nursing staff and compliance with guidelines and standards set by all external governing bodies. The Nursing Supervisor is required to provide customer service to both internal and external parties.

PRIMARY JOB EXPECTATIONS

1. Supervision and Leadership
• Builds and maintains a positive team by providing guidance, support and direction to all assigned staff
• Provides accountability to assigned staff through supervisions, evaluations, and any necessary discipline.
• Helps to identify and implement needed trainings to aid in professional development of assigned staff.
• Oversees all aspects of the medical department including nursing services, psychiatric medication reviews and orders by the Medical Director
• Oversees medication administration and ensures the medical needs of clients are met
• Maintains nursing schedule to ensure there is proper 24-hour on call nursing available
• Provides medical services training, and specialized training as needed, for all direct care staff
• Provides direction to program personnel to ensure appropriate medical care occurs.
• Is available for on call consultation, as needed.

2. Administrative Tasks
• Ensures the secure and confidential maintenance of health records (initial screenings, periodic health exams, dental exams, psychotropic medications and optical examinations)
• Ensures that all observations and incidents, including accidents, injuries, or any other condition which may be associated with health conditions are properly documented.
• Ensures appropriate follow up occurs regarding medical issues, plans of care, development of procedures, etc.
• Responsible for communication and accountability with the designated pharmacy as it relates to security and delivery of medications, timeliness of medications, prior authorizations and STAT medications

3. Compliance
• Ensures strict adherence to regulations set by all external governing agencies
• Conducts and/or facilitates monthly medical audits in all programs
• Conducts quarterly Medical Quality Assurance meetings
• Maintains database for all medical records on campus and enters all required information into the client software system.
• Ensures compliance with state and federal laws

SUPERVISORY RESPONSIBILITIES
This position supervises the LPN’s that are on staff (typically 5-7 LPN’s) and 2 Medication Staff

WORKING CONDITIONS
Typical work week is Monday-Friday 40 hours and participates in an on call rotation. The Nursing Supervisor will have regular contact with YOC program/clinical staff members, members of office administration, and YOC executive staff members. Direct contact with local and state agencies, vendors and contractors by phone and in person is a function of this position. Direct contact with residents, parents/guardians, doctors and pharmacists is also required. Courtesy and professionalism are expected at all times.
